- The distance between Woodstock, Va, Usa and Morada Nova, Brazil is approximately 6,394 km or 3,973 mi.
- To reach Woodstock, Va in this distance one would set out from Morada Nova bearing 323.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Woodstock, Va bearing 310.4° or NW .
- Woodstock, Va has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Morada Nova has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Woodstock, Va is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Morada Nova is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 14.5 °C (26.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.3 °C (38.3°F) more in Woodstock, Va.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 22.1 mm (0.9 in) more which is equivalent to 22.1 l/m² (0.54 US gal/ft²) or 221,000 l/ha (23,626 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23° lower in Woodstock, Va than in Morada Nova.
